diff options
author | Luke Shumaker <lukeshu@parabola.nu> | 2017-02-15 14:42:06 -0500 |
---|---|---|
committer | Luke Shumaker <lukeshu@parabola.nu> | 2017-02-19 14:21:30 -0500 |
commit | c1063cd6752afe778d44f6f88326d95f01300377 (patch) | |
tree | 2557fc4776df8cf18eb29505810c3ca5db337f0d /lddd.in | |
parent | ab2987efab9d1f62be582f5dce08c9906d46b3c4 (diff) | |
download | devtools32-c1063cd6752afe778d44f6f88326d95f01300377.tar.xz |
checkpkg, find-libdeps, finddeps, lddd: Use libremessages to add help text.
Diffstat (limited to 'lddd.in')
-rw-r--r-- | lddd.in | 18 |
1 files changed, 17 insertions, 1 deletions
@@ -4,7 +4,23 @@ # # License: Unspecified -m4_include(lib/common.sh) +. "$(librelib messages)" + +usage() { + print "Usage: %s [-h]" "${0##*/}" + print "Find broken library links on your machine." + echo + prose 'Scans $PATH and library directories for ELF files with + references to missing shared libraries.' +} + +if [[ $1 = '-h' ]]; then + usage + exit 0 +elif [[ $# -gt 0 ]]; then + usage >&2 + exit 1 +fi ifs=$IFS IFS="${IFS}:" |